Technology for the poor! And do not laugh. What do the manufacturer, which focuses on consumers, each with a little money, but these consumers tens of millions? Properly, it makes a cheap product and calls it “Freedom”!

More precisely – Freedom 251, which announced in India. The main sensation is that the 251 in the title is the price. In rupees! Ie 251 new Freedom is worth so much – a little less than 4 dollars at the current exchange rate is obtained. They say that for the money in India will be able to buy even those for whom the portion of “Venti latte” in there Starbucks is a luxury.

On the official website of Freedom 251 write that for their rupees the buyer gets a real smartphone with 4-inch IPS display, 1 gig of RAM, 8 gigs of internal memory, slot for memory cards with capacity of up to 32GB, main camera is 3.2 megapixels and front 0.3. About the product’s performance yet do not tell, but we know that % have Freedom 251 4-core with an operating frequency of 1.3 GHz, and the BATT has enough capacity (1450 mAh). As the OS uses Android Lollipop though, plus a bunch of preinstalled applications included Whatsapp, Facebook and YouTube (see the video).

On sale Freedom 251 promise to release exactly on 30 June of this year. The new product developed by a little-known company Ringing Bells in the framework initiated and supported by the government of the state of the program Make in India.

However, according to the publication XDA Developers, after local media reports yesterday showed photos of prototypes of the device with the logo of Adcom (one of India’s largest importers), the public began indignantly to learn in Freedom 251 “converted” Adcom Ikon 4 in India selling for 3,599 rupees ($53).
